Apparently, Big Top is a company that specializes in desserts that are a little…shall we say…husky.

The giant cupcake is made up of three parts: the muffin top, a spacer for a cream center and the bottom. The spacer is not a required element, but if you are going to make a giant cupcake why not go the extra mile. You bake the two main pieces separately and then combine then, once cooked, to create a dessert that will put you into a sugar coma. Needless to say, these are not supposed to be eaten by one person. It’s basically a new take on a cake recipe for birthday parties, etc.
